FS 2020 1.10.11.0 crash

Featured Replies

After the 1.10.11.0 update my game doesn't start anymore. I have a blackscreen with a loading symbol at the bottom right corner for a few seconds after I launch the game. At his poin the game just closes. Does anyone have similar problems? Image: https://imgur.com/a/cIqcK33

PC:

Intel Xeon X5670

rx 570 4gb

12gb ddr3

What I tried:

- AMD driver update

- Removed content from the community folder

- Disabled OC

- Disabled startup programs

- Disabled Antivirus

- Re-installed Miscrosoft Visual Studio

I can't and also don't want to re install the game. I don't want to install over 150gb and discover that the problem isn't gone or that the next update would have fixed the problem. Is waiting all I can do?
